About This Item

Paperback / softback. New. This book examines the debates around modernity and postmodernity from the viewpoint of feminist theory. The author assesses classical social theory, theories of the Enlightenment and the more recent modernity/postmodernity debates arguing that at each stage, social theory has failed to give enough attention to questions of gender.
